COMP 242 - DNA An amazing blend of biology, chemistry, computing and mathematics emerges when considering the molecule “deoxyribonucleic acid” (DNA). DNA is the blueprint of life for all organisms on Earth and throughout evolutionary time. This course explores DNA from the following four points of view: molecular biology, applied mathematics, evolutionary biology and computer science. Students will analyze DNA sequences by learning to write computer programs (software) in the language Python. Learning to write programs is a pure, distilled form of problem solving, a vital skill for many careers and graduate studies. Historical and ethical aspects of DNA are discussed.
Prerequisites One course in Biology or one course in Computer Science or one course in Mathematics or Permission of Instructor
Credits 4
Notes Cross-listed with BIO 242
